Amy received her B.A. degree in Economics from Ïã½¶ÊÓÆµ, and her Ph.D. in Economics from the University of Notre Dame in Indiana.
She returned to teach at Ïã½¶ÊÓÆµ in 2001 after several years at Hanover College in Indiana. Amy teaches macroeconomic theory courses, Money and Financial Markets, Economic Development and Extreme Economics. She is a co-faculty advisor for the Omicron Delta Epsilon (ODE) economics honorary.
Her interests include teaching economics in K-12 through literature, the Nature Explore/Outdoor Classroom Project and Heifer International.
